Have you ruled out the clutch safety switch? It wont turn over unless the clutch safety switch is closed. There could also be a corroded fuse that supplies power to the switch or starter solenoid circuit, might be worth removing and cleaning every fuse just to make sure that's not a problem. Attached is a pic of the "Ford" switch to supliment the info Greg supplied. Google search part# E7NN11N501AB to find a supplier. Nice of Greg to offer his spare switch. Pin / connection
1 / Off connect to hot (+12 )
2 / For tractor power (Lights, gauges) + any accy's.
3 / To glow plugs
4 / To alternator field winding (provided you upgraded to the Delco 12SI)
5 / Starter solenoid (through clutch safety switch)


Here are the contacts vs key position:
Key position starting all the way CCW

Key Position 0 - 4
0 - OFF (no connection) except +12 to pin 1 of the switch
1 - (1 click CW) Pin 1+2 (Tractor lights and gauges only)
2 - (2 clicks CW) Pin 1+2+4 (Delco Alternator 12SI field energize) + Tractor power, lights, gauges + any accys).
3 - (3 clicks CW Spring return back to 2) 1+3 (Glow Plugs only)
4 - (4 clicks CW Spring return back to 2) 1+3+5 (start+glow plugs)

Of particular note - this switch is one of few were glow plugs are hot at same time starter is engaged. The OEM switches do not do that so it's a definite advantage to have one of these switches installed (provided you have glow plugs).
